Product name | Swing-N-Slide "Mega Rider" Swings |
Description | The recalled backyard playground "Mega Rider" swing can be used by one or two children. The blue-colored plastic "Mega Rider" is suspended from a crossbeam by four plastic-coated chains. Children sitting back-to-back push in different directions to make the swing move back and forth. Printed on the handle below the seat connection in raised lettering are the words, "Swing-N-Slide," 1212 Barberry Drive, Janesville, WI, Made in U.S.A., 1-800-888-1232, THIS PRODUCT IS INTENDED FOR USE BY CHILDREN FROM THE AGES OF 2 TO 10 YEARS. READ INSTRUCTIONS PRIOR TO USE." |
Problem | The plastic handle on the Mega Rider swing could crack at the seat connection allowing the metal connecting the rod to pull out. If this occurs, a child on the swing could fall to the ground. |
Distribution | Nationwide at Lowe's and Home Depot stores by special order and through Ace, DIBC, TruServ, Handy Hardware, Emery Warehouse, and Federated co-ops and buying groups. |
Company | Swing-N-Slide - 800-888-1232. |
Dates sold | March 2003 through October 2003. |
